Reported by: Dave Benton / WCIA 3 Monday, May 18, 2009 @02:27pm CDT SAVOY & CHAMPAIGN - Criminals swung through two towns in one weekend. They ripped off at least eight families. In Crime Watch tonight, police need your help finding the bad guys. The crime spree happened the weekend of May 9th. The burglaries occurred in the 1200 block of Quail Run, 100 block of Red Wing and the 600 block of Pheasant Lane in Savoy. Also in the 2800 block of West Curtis Road, 2300 block of Valleybrook, 2200 block of Edgewater, 2700 block of Prairie Meadow and the 2100 block of Woodland Glen in Southwest Champaign. Among the items taken: purses, wallets, video games, cell phones and a bicycle. Also taken a 2007 Honda Civic, computers and cash. The bad guys rummaged through unlocked garages and cars. In one case, the culprits got into the house because they used the garage door opener in an unlocked car. If you have any information, call Champaign County Crimestoppers at 373-TIPS.
